This sculpture is different from the majority of typical horse sculptures that are very flowing and liquid in their movements.   Mine has more of a unicorn inspiration in it's stance, head position, and tail form. 

The TIG welding method I use in my craft, doesn’t allow for smooth curves, so the end result is very rigid, stringent lines.   I think it gives a majestic sense to the horse and I am very pleased with it's appearance.


This piece is another example of the faceted perforated steel used in the Easter Island Head and the Shark sculpture.  It is a fun technique that gives great dimension to the sculpture. 

 

SCULPTURE SPECS:  Cor Ten Steel       77" H x 62" W x 32" D     2008
